Hardwood Floor Removal in Santa Rosa, CA
Hardwood floor removal services involve the careful and efficient process of taking out existing hardwood flooring from a property. This service is often requested during home renovations, remodeling projects, or when replacing damaged or outdated flooring.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of removal, including whether the existing subfloor will be affected, and if the process will generate dust or debris. It’s also common to inquire about the methods used to ensure the surrounding areas and underlying surfaces remain protected during removal.
Projects that commonly require hardwood floor removal include preparing for new flooring installations, addressing water or termite damage, or clearing space for other renovations. Homeowners should consider factors such as the type of hardwood, the age of the flooring, and the condition of the subfloor before requesting removal. Understanding these details helps ensure the process is smooth and that any necessary repairs or preparations can be planned accordingly to support the next phase of the flooring project.

Hardwood Floor Removal Questions
What is hardwood floor removal? Hardwood floor removal involves safely taking up existing hardwood planks to prepare for new flooring or other renovations.
When should hardwood floors be removed? Removal is typically needed when floors are damaged, outdated, or to facilitate remodeling projects.
What methods are used for hardwood floor removal? The process usually includes carefully prying up the planks, removing nails, and cleaning the subfloor for the next phase.
Is hardwood floor removal messy? The process can create dust and debris, which is managed with proper containment and cleanup measures.
